UO.Note No:58414-3, Dt:07-02-2001 | CCARules - Appointment of Departmental Enquiry Officer - Instructions

GOVERNMENT OF ANDHRA PRADESH
GENERAL ADMN. (SER.C) DEPARTMENT 

U.O.Note No.58414/Ser.C/2000-3                                                     Dated: 07.02.2001

 

Sub:- Public Services-Disciplinary Cases-Placing the accused officers on defence before the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ings - Format prescribed - Communicated.

- - -

The disciplinary cases emanated out of investigations by the Anti-Corruption Bureau or otherwise for imposing any of the penalties specified in Clauses (vi) to (x) of rule 9 of the Andhra Pradesh Civil Services (CC&A) Rules, 1991 are required to be inquired into either by appointing Departmental Enquiry Officers or by the Commissioner of inquiries or by placing the accused officers on his defence before the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ings. In G.O.Ms.No.82, General Administration (Services.C) Department, dt.01.03.1996, A format for appointment of Inquiring Authority was also prescribed.

2.   Under Sub-rule (I) of rule 3 of the Andhra Pradesh Civil Services (Disciplinary Proceedings Tribunal) Rules, 1989 and instruction 8 (8) and 8 (9) of the Andhra Pradesh Vigilance Commission Procedural Instructions, the Government is empowered to take a decision in consultation with the Vigilance Commissioner, Andhra Pradesh Vigilance Commission for placing Government Employee or Employees on defence before the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ings.

3.  Accordingly, a format to place the accused Government Employee or Employees on defence before the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ings is Annexed to this U.O. Note.

4. The Departments of Secretariat are requested to follow the format, while issuing orders entrusting the disciplinary case, for detailed inquiry, to the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ings.

ANNEXURE

(Under Memo No.58414/Ser.C/2000-4, GAD (Ser.C), Dt:07.02.2001)

 

Memo No. Dated:

 

Sub: Public Services - Disciplinary Cases - Inquiry against Sri/Smt. (Designation and Department) - The Accused Officer placed on defence before the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ings – Orders - Issued.
*****
    Discreet enquiries conducted by the appropriate authority on allegations relating to corruption/ misappropriation / misconduct against Sri/Smt. ________________ (Designation and Department) reveal prima-facie the need to probe the matter in detail. The Government have decided to entrust the case against the said individual(s) to the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ings for detailed and regular inquiry into the allegations.


    Under rule 3 of the Andhra Pradesh Civil Services (Disciplinary Proceedings Tribunal) Rules, 1989, Sri/ Smt. __________ (Designation and Department) is placed on defence before the Disciplinary Proceedings Tribunal to inquire into the allegation(s) ________ (Corruption/Misappropriation/Misconduct), The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ings shall conduct enquiry as per rules and submit its report to the Government within the stipulated period.


    The Director General, Anti-Corruption Bureau shall furnish all relevant records and material to the Tribunal for Disciplinary Proceedings to conduct inquiry.
